Viora is proud to announce that Dr. Richard M. Goldfarb will be joining Viora as Medical Director. In this capacity, Dr. Goldfarb will oversee and guide all clinical aspects of Viora and its products. Highly respected and esteemed in the medical aesthetics industry, with over 30 years of general and vascular surgery experience, Dr. Goldfarb is uniquely qualified to lead Vioras clinical course.

Viora is the developer of devices for medical aesthetic practitioners and aestheticians, and the manufacturer of the ground-breaking multi-frequency bi-polar RF device, Reaction, which performs body contouring, cellulite reduction and skin tightening procedures. Other products include Trios- the advanced phototherapy system for long-term hair removal, treatment of vascular and pigmented lesions and acne clearance, Infusion a needle-free electro-mesotherapy device for skin rejuvenation, and Pristine an award-winning microdermabrasion diamond tip device.

Toltek Services LLC’s Maintenance Guru takes a que from the Shell Answer Man from the 1970s and provides tips to saving energy. Through TV commercials in the 1950s, many Americans learned how to stretch more miles out of a tank of gas. Those lessons have been passed down to generations of drivers. Now, Toltek Services, LLC’s Maintenance Guru offers advice to help the world get the most from each kilowatt hour of electricity.

Thermostat Control: Turn thermostats down in the winter and up in the summer when nobody is home. There is no need to fully heat or cool unoccupied spaces. Programmable thermostats can be purchased for under $ 50. Individuals are then able to customize room temperatures based on occupancy. The cost savings can be so significant that many people reduce their energy consumption by 30% or more. Always keep enough heat that pipes dont freeze inside and that your pets do not suffer.

Filter Changes: Change filters regularly, some have to change them monthly in areas with construction, dust, wind, and pets that shed. Others can get up to three months from a single filter.

Water Heater: Water heaters should be turned off when people go on vacation and do not need hot water. Think of leaving a 50 gallon pot of water on the stove 24 hours a day, seven days a week. Home center stores now carry timers so people can have hot water in the morning and evenings when needed and conserve the energy during the day and night when no hot water is used.

Washing Machine: Only run full loads of clothes. The savings are both in electricity and in soap, softener, and other laundry additives.

Clothes Dryers: Clean lint traps after every load and remove the dryer hose at least once each year to check for lint build-up. New dryer hoses cost about $ 15 and are much cheaper than experiencing a home fire because of a plugged dryer hose.

Dish Washer: Only run the dish washer when it is full for the same reasons as stated above concerning washing machines.

Ceiling Fans: Ceiling fans neither heat nor cool spaces. They simply move air around to give the skin a sensation of cooling. Heat rises and cool air drops, ceiling fans are a great way to circulate air and keep a room at a constant temperature from the floor to the ceiling. Turn ceiling fans off when the room is not occupied.

Lighting: Replace incandescent light bulbs with the new energy efficient bulbs.

Set Goals: This tip could be the best tip of all because everyone in the family or office can make a difference. Review the March 2011 utility bill and determine the kilowatt hours paid. Next, determine a reasonable reduction goal; the Maintenance Guru suggests starting out with 5% because most homes and offices can reach the 5% goal. Getting families members and co-workers involved helps to obtain the goal. A weekly discussion about steps everyone has taken to help achieve the goal is helpful in keeping the awareness level high. Goal setting along with follow-up discussions reinforce lessons learn. These lessons will be passed down from generation to generation just like the vehicle and gasoline lessons learned from the Shell Answer Man over 30 years ago.

Massage Envy Fredericksburg in Virginia just announced that they will be sponsoring their client Patricia Boord in her journey to the World Masters Bench Press Championship, as she was recently named a member of Team USA. Boord was overweight and a diabetic, but turned to massage therapy in Fredericksburg, VA at Massage Envy and weight lifting to turn her health around.

Boord started her journey towards better health in 2006 when she joined Massage Envy Fredericksburg and began seeing one of their massage therapists in Fredericksburg, VA, Christina Amaya, along with her trainer Peggy Hayes. One of the things I have come to rely on are my bi-weekly massages with Christina, says Boord. I train hard and my muscles take a beating, but Christina just fixes them all. I consider my visits to her just as important as the time I spend in the gym.

Since 2006, Boord has lost 54 pounds, no longer takes insulin and has discontinued taking two blood pressure medications. This past year, Boord won the 100% Raw Virginia State Championship/American Challenge National Bench Press Championship, the 100% Raw Eastern US Open, the USAPL National Bench Press Championship. She is now qualified for the World Masters Bench Press Championship and a member of Team USA.
